ML Platform adds teacher–student curriculum learning capability
AI Impact Summary
Teacher–student curriculum learning introduces a training paradigm where a teacher guides a student through progressively harder tasks to improve data efficiency and generalization. Integrating this capability requires updating training pipelines to support curriculum construction, staged learning, and combined loss weighting. The business benefit is higher model performance with limited labeled data, but there is added complexity in hyperparameter tuning and potential increases in training time and dependency on a teacher model and curriculum design.
Business Impact
Adopting curriculum learning can yield higher accuracy with the same labeled data and reduce labeling costs, but initial deployment will require changes to training pipelines and hyperparameter management, potentially slowing early rollout.
